Job description

Job Title: Packaging Associate

Location: In-person, Phoenix, AZ 85009

Schedule: Monday-Thursday, 4 10-hour shifts (6:30am–5:00pm), Occasional optional overtime on Fridays

Compensation: Starting at $16.50/hour

Flow Distribution is seeking motivated and detail-oriented Packaging Associates to join our Manufacturing and Packaging team for an immediate start. The ideal candidate is reliable, quality-focused, and able to thrive in a fast-paced production environment. This position is responsible for accurately packaging cannabis products in compliance with company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), safety regulations, and Arizona state cannabis laws. Active Arizona Facility Agent card preferred.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Packaging and manufacturing responsibilities including, but not limited to, counting, sorting, labeling, sealing, boxing, and taping products according to SOPs.
  • Meet or exceed personal and team production goals set by management.
  • Perform visual quality control checks to ensure product and packaging meet standards.
  • Communicate immediately with the Production Manager if any product concerns or discrepancies arise.
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and sanitary workspace before, during, and after each shift.
  • Operate all machinery and packaging equipment according to company safety protocols and manufacturer guidelines.
  • Stage workstations for the next shift by preparing necessary materials and equipment.
  • Follow all company and Arizona state compliance standards and regulations.
  • Maintain confidentiality and handle inventory responsibly.
  • Participate in routine cleaning, maintenance, and organization of tools and equipment.
  • Support other departments as needed to meet production deadlines.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the Production Manager or supervisor.
